I'm currently several scenarios into the 1814 campaign and are now at Troyes. Something is off - if I open the scenario in the editor it should be 80 hex visibility but it's actually 1 hex in clear daylight! A very minor correction to the file is needed. Is it the pdt file that controls visibility? And if so what line. I just can't work it out. If it is the pdt it'll be the NSLS Feb 22 one. Or possibly the Feb 21st one - the scenario in question is set on 22nd but refers to the 21 Feb pdt.

Guys - I was able to find the problem. As Andy says an incorrect PDT file was referenced in the scenarios. Not only just Andy's but 3 of the 4 scenarios in that Branch of the NSLS-HTH campaign.

I did a spot check of the other campaigns but so far no other issues. As much as I can I will check the rest of the scenarios to see if any others have similar issues.

I put the entire set of campaigns together for 1814 in ONE month. Most amazing amount of work I have ever done. That there are not more errors is totally amazing. Those were some frantic times. I had put out Leipzig, 1814 followed in six months and Bautzen six months after that.
